// The following function encodes a variable in a std140 or std430 block. The variable could be:
//
// - An interface block: In this case, |decorationsBlob| is provided and SPIR-V decorations are
// output to this blob.
// - A struct: In this case, the return value is of interest as the size of the struct in the
// encoding.
//
// This function ignores arrayness in calculating the struct size.
//
uint32_t Encode(const ShaderVariable &var,
bool isStd140,
spirv::IdRef blockTypeId,
spirv::Blob *decorationsBlob)
{
Std140BlockEncoder std140;
Std430BlockEncoder std430;
BlockLayoutEncoder *encoder = isStd140 ? &std140 : &std430;
ASSERT(var.isStruct());
encoder->enterAggregateType(var);
uint32_t fieldIndex = 0;
for (const ShaderVariable &fieldVar : var.fields)
{
BlockMemberInfo fieldInfo;
// Encode the variable.
if (fieldVar.isStruct())
{
// For structs, recursively encode it.
const uint32_t structSize = Encode(fieldVar, isStd140, {}, nullptr);
encoder->enterAggregateType(fieldVar);
fieldInfo = encoder->encodeArrayOfPreEncodedStructs(structSize, fieldVar.arraySizes);
encoder->exitAggregateType(fieldVar);
}
else
{
fieldInfo =
encoder->encodeType(fieldVar.type, fieldVar.arraySizes, fieldVar.isRowMajorLayout);
}
if (decorationsBlob)
{
ASSERT(blockTypeId.valid());
// Write the Offset decoration.
spirv::WriteMemberDecorate(decorationsBlob, blockTypeId,
spirv::LiteralInteger(fieldIndex), spv::DecorationOffset,
{spirv::LiteralInteger(fieldInfo.offset)});
// For matrix types, write the MatrixStride decoration as well.
if (IsMatrixGLType(fieldVar.type))
{
ASSERT(fieldInfo.matrixStride > 0);
// MatrixStride
spirv::WriteMemberDecorate(
decorationsBlob, blockTypeId, spirv::LiteralInteger(fieldIndex),
spv::DecorationMatrixStride, {spirv::LiteralInteger(fieldInfo.matrixStride)});
}
}
++fieldIndex;
}
encoder->exitAggregateType(var);
return static_cast<uint32_t>(encoder->getCurrentOffset());
}

// Get id of the component type of the image
SpirvType sampledSpirvType;
sampledSpirvType.type = sampledType;
*sampledTypeOut = getSpirvTypeData(sampledSpirvType, nullptr).id;
const bool isSampledImage = IsSampler(type);
// Set flags based on SPIR-V required values. See OpTypeImage:
//
// - For depth: 0 = non-depth, 1 = depth
// - For arrayed: 0 = non-arrayed, 1 = arrayed
// - For multisampled: 0 = single-sampled, 1 = multisampled
// - For sampled: 1 = sampled, 2 = storage
//
*depthOut = spirv::LiteralInteger(isDepth ? 1 : 0);
*arrayedOut = spirv::LiteralInteger(isArrayed ? 1 : 0);
*multisampledOut = spirv::LiteralInteger(isMultisampled ? 1 : 0);
*sampledOut = spirv::LiteralInteger(isSampledImage ? 1 : 2);
// Add the necessary capability based on parameters. The SPIR-V spec section 3.8 Dim specfies
// the required capabilities:
//
// Dim Sampled Storage Storage Array
// --------------------------------------------------------------
// 2D Shader ImageMSArray
// 3D
// Cube Shader ImageCubeArray
// Rect SampledRect ImageRect
// Buffer SampledBuffer ImageBuffer
//
// Additionally, the SubpassData Dim requires the InputAttachment capability.
//
// Note that the Shader capability is always unconditionally added.
//
switch (*dimOut)
{
case spv::Dim2D:
if (!isSampledImage && isArrayed && isMultisampled)
{
addCapability(spv::CapabilityImageMSArray);
}
break;
case spv::Dim3D:
break;
case spv::DimCube:
if (!isSampledImage && isArrayed)
{
addCapability(spv::CapabilityImageCubeArray);
}
break;
case spv::DimRect:
addCapability(isSampledImage ? spv::CapabilitySampledRect : spv::CapabilityImageRect);
break;
case spv::DimBuffer:
addCapability(isSampledImage ? spv::CapabilitySampledBuffer
: spv::CapabilityImageBuffer);
break;
case spv::DimSubpassData:
addCapability(spv::CapabilityInputAttachment);
break;
default:
UNREACHABLE();
}
}

spirv::Blob SPIRVBuilder::getSpirv()
{
ASSERT(mConditionalStack.empty());
spirv::Blob result;
const spirv::IdRef nonSemanticOverviewId = getNewId({});
// Reserve a minimum amount of memory.
//
// 5 for header +
// a number of capabilities +
// size of already generated instructions.
//
// The actual size is larger due to other metadata instructions such as extensions,
// OpExtInstImport, OpEntryPoint, OpExecutionMode etc.
result.reserve(5 + mCapabilities.size() * 2 + mSpirvDebug.size() + mSpirvDecorations.size() +
mSpirvTypeAndConstantDecls.size() + mSpirvTypePointerDecls.size() +
mSpirvFunctionTypeDecls.size() + mSpirvVariableDecls.size() +
mSpirvFunctions.size());
// Generate the SPIR-V header.
spirv::WriteSpirvHeader(&result,
mCompileOptions.emitSPIRV14 ? spirv::kVersion_1_4 : spirv::kVersion_1_3,
mNextAvailableId);
// Generate metadata in the following order:
//
// - OpCapability instructions.
for (spv::Capability capability : mCapabilities)
{
spirv::WriteCapability(&result, capability);
}
// - OpExtension instructions
writeExtensions(&result);
// Enable the SPV_KHR_non_semantic_info extension to more efficiently communicate information to
// the SPIR-V transformer in the Vulkan backend. The relevant instructions are all stripped
// away during SPIR-V transformation so the driver never needs to support it.
spirv::WriteExtension(&result, "SPV_KHR_non_semantic_info");
// - OpExtInstImport
spirv::WriteExtInstImport(&result, getExtInstImportIdStd(), "GLSL.std.450");
spirv::WriteExtInstImport(&result, spirv::IdRef(vk::spirv::kIdNonSemanticInstructionSet),
"NonSemantic.ANGLE");
// - OpMemoryModel
spirv::WriteMemoryModel(&result, spv::AddressingModelLogical, spv::MemoryModelGLSL450);
// - OpEntryPoint
constexpr gl::ShaderMap<spv::ExecutionModel> kExecutionModels = {
{gl::ShaderType::Vertex, spv::ExecutionModelVertex},
{gl::ShaderType::TessControl, spv::ExecutionModelTessellationControl},
{gl::ShaderType::TessEvaluation, spv::ExecutionModelTessellationEvaluation},
{gl::ShaderType::Geometry, spv::ExecutionModelGeometry},
{gl::ShaderType::Fragment, spv::ExecutionModelFragment},
{gl::ShaderType::Compute, spv::ExecutionModelGLCompute},
};
spirv::WriteEntryPoint(&result, kExecutionModels[mShaderType],
spirv::IdRef(vk::spirv::kIdEntryPoint), "main",
mEntryPointInterfaceList);
// - OpExecutionMode instructions
writeExecutionModes(&result);
// - OpSource and OpSourceExtension instructions.
//
// This is to support debuggers and capture/replay tools and isn't strictly necessary.
spirv::WriteSource(&result, spv::SourceLanguageGLSL, spirv::LiteralInteger(450), nullptr,
nullptr);
writeSourceExtensions(&result);
// Append the already generated sections in order
result.insert(result.end(), mSpirvDebug.begin(), mSpirvDebug.end());
result.insert(result.end(), mSpirvDecorations.begin(), mSpirvDecorations.end());
result.insert(result.end(), mSpirvTypeAndConstantDecls.begin(),
mSpirvTypeAndConstantDecls.end());
result.insert(result.end(), mSpirvTypePointerDecls.begin(), mSpirvTypePointerDecls.end());
result.insert(result.end(), mSpirvFunctionTypeDecls.begin(), mSpirvFunctionTypeDecls.end());
result.insert(result.end(), mSpirvVariableDecls.begin(), mSpirvVariableDecls.end());
// The types/constants/variables section is the first place non-semantic instructions can be
// output. These instructions rely on at least the OpVoid type. The kNonSemanticTypeSectionEnd
// instruction additionally carries an overview of the SPIR-V and thus requires a few OpConstant
// values.
writeNonSemanticOverview(&result, nonSemanticOverviewId);
result.insert(result.end(), mSpirvFunctions.begin(), mSpirvFunctions.end());
result.shrink_to_fit();
return result;
}
